A "BENCHMARK used in the VPP. The proportion of users who successfully cast a ballot (whether or not the ballot contains erroneous votes). Failure to cast a ballot might involve problems such as a voter simply "giving up" during the because of an VOTING SESSION inability to operate the system, or a mistaken belief that one has successfully operated the casting mechanism." VVSG.
